Transaction e3edfbbc133d013f2adebe903283e238bcfc3ba95939ce2f1782d7d2cdf59565
1 Input
1 Output
-
e3edfbbc133d013f2adebe903283e238bcfc3ba95939ce2f1782d7d2cdf59565:0
- value
- 8382916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b7e5652d19cf86f6f02e4fc660d51e0d897fac1 OP_EQUAL
- address
- 3CwzPCeBieUKsMB7HBYcsaLoqJMHCSJ9Zj